Bernard A. Sampson
Chef de Chemin de Fer
- -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- -
     Bernie was born in Woodville, New York on March 29th, 1947. He graduated from Belleville High School in 1966 and joined the Marine Corps. He was stationed in Viet Nam where he earned the Purple Heart, Vietnam Medal, Vietnam Service Medal, National Defense Service Medal and Rifle Expert Medal.
- -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- -
     Bernie is a Charter Member of Jefferson County Voiture 534, joining at it’s reorganization in 1990. As a 40/8 member, Bernie has held all Locale, District and Grande Offices as well as several Nationale Offices.
- -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- -
     Bernie is retired from the Marine Corps. He lives in his hometown of Woodville, New York with his wife, Terry. They have three grown children and four grandchildren. Bernie has been an Active Member of the Veteran Organizations and a lifetime supporter of the Sporting Groups in his Community. He has been active in Little League, Pop Warner, the Bowling Association, Men’s Softball and the Tavern Pool League. He is a Paid up for Life member of the American Legion, the VFW, the DAV, and the Marine Corps League. In his “spare time”, Bernie is an avid golfer.

United Service Organizations USO
- -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- -
     The USO is a private Charity Organization that relies on the generosity of the Public for the Support of their Activities. They provide Morale, Welfare, and Recreational Services to United States Military Personnel and their Families worldwide.
     American Legion Auxiliary Units are encouraged to contact their local USO, as they might need donations of supplies. Also, Auxiliary Members can Volunteer by working in the Canteen or manning the USO Site in your area.

     You can find the nearest USO by going online to  http://www.uso.org  then clicking on the Locations Directory. Monetary donations can be made to your local USO or to the USO World Headquarters by calling 1-800-876-7469. These contributions are used to purchase personal need items for the Servicemen and Women visiting the USO or furnishing the local USO facility.

CaringBridge
- -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- -
     CaringBridge is a Nonprofit Service that allows Families to stay in touch through Internet Online Journals when a loved one is hospitalized. Fisher House Foundation, best known for building and supporting a network of "Comfort Homes" on the grounds of all major Military Medical Centers and several VA Medical Centers, had previously arranged for access to CaringBridge at all Fisher Houses and at any Military Health Care facility.

Fisher House Foundation
- -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- -
     The Fisher House program is a unique private-public partnership that supports America's Military in their time of need. The program recognizes the Special Sacrifices of our Men and Women in uniform and the hardships of Military Service by meeting a Humanitarian Need beyond that normally provided by the Department of Defense and the Department of Veterans Affairs.
